“…These FASS are robust against perturbations, and their range of stable existence is used to measure the robust strength of topological semimetals. Generally, both Weyl nodes and FASS have been extensively studied in the gyromagnetic photonic crystals and continuous media [21][22][23][24][25][26][27][28]. The FASS can achieve robust transmission through arbitrary defects due to the systems breaking of time-reversal symmetry under an external magnetic field.…”
